The Jacob Marley Manhattan Recipe

Ingredients
  • 1 1/4 oz. Sazerac 18 year rye
  • 1 oz. Licor 43 (is a bright yellow Spanish liqueur. It is made from citrus and fruit juices, flavored with vanilla and other aromatic herbs and spices, in total 43 different ingredients (hence the name).
  • 1 oz. Château de Laubade Bas-Armagnac XO (one of the finest Brandys)

Directions
  1. Combine ingredients in a shaker with ice.
  2. Shake well and strain and pour into chilled martini glass.
  3. Garnish with a homemade spun sugar peppermint stirrer...Or for some of us a nice Peppermint Stick :)
